Grade 6 Initiative

At the YMCA, we want youth to be healthy and engaged in their community which is why we created our Grade 6 Initiative. As a part of our partnership with the 2015 Canada Winter Games, this legacy program provides all Grade 6 students in Prince George a free YMCA membership to provide them a safe place to stay active and to develop healthy habits for years to come.

Tiny Tumblers: Mondays • 10:30am-11:45am
Rec Room • Ages 3-5 years

Hop, skip, tumble, and roll. Through exploring movement skills such as a tuck jump, log roll, or bear walk your child will develop balance, coordination, and kinaesthetic awareness.

Active Artists: Wednesdays • 10:30am-11:45am
Child Minding Room • Ages 3-5 years

Focused on letting kids express their creative energy, this program is designed to help children develop their hand-eye coordination, spatial awareness, and basic shapes/patterns. Children will engage in hands-on learning through activities such as finger painting, building boats out of popsicle sticks, or even slime experiments!
